Transaction 216580963c4057adcb4a8ba90df097c23f09093e296762c7c2e5a11660c08346

1 Input
2 Outputs
  • 216580963c4057adcb4a8ba90df097c23f09093e296762c7c2e5a11660c08346:0
  • value  32993
    address  12hJfdYcKcm9Awg3BJF1EEPcXvHrTSjxXz
  • 216580963c4057adcb4a8ba90df097c23f09093e296762c7c2e5a11660c08346:1
  • value  255989
    address  3MkSteVvjjx6PhWnjQHYVS3NV74e3dGNTh